Common Stove Problems in Brightwood
Several issues can arise with modern stoves, ranging from minor inconveniences to significant operational failures. For electric stoves, a prevalent problem is uneven heating or a burner that fails to ignite altogether. This can be due to faulty heating elements, damaged wiring, or a malfunctioning infinite switch. Conversely, gas stoves may present challenges with igniters not sparking, a weak or flickering flame, or a gas odor, which is a serious concern and requires immediate attention from a qualified professional. Oven components, whether electric or gas, can also fail. This might manifest as an oven that doesn’t heat to the set temperature, temperature fluctuations during cooking, or a broiler that isn’t working. Door issues, such as a hinge that’s become loose or a seal that’s worn out, can also impact heat retention and efficiency.

When to Consider Stove Replacement
While stove repair is often the most cost-effective solution, there are instances where replacing your appliance may be a more prudent long-term investment. If your stove is nearing the end of its average lifespan, typically 10-15 years for most models, and is requiring frequent or costly repairs, it might be time to consider an upgrade. The cumulative cost of repairs could soon outweigh the expense of a new, more energy-efficient, and technologically advanced unit. Additionally, if your current stove is excessively outdated and lacks modern safety features or energy-saving capabilities, a replacement can offer improved performance, lower utility bills, and enhanced kitchen functionality. Modern stoves come with a range of innovative features, from precise temperature controls to self-cleaning cycles, which can significantly improve your cooking experience.
Ensuring Continued Stove Performance
Once your stove has been repaired or replaced, adopting a proactive approach to maintenance can help extend its lifespan and prevent future issues. Regular cleaning is paramount; this includes wiping down surfaces after each use, removing spills promptly, and deep cleaning the oven and cooktop as recommended by the manufacturer. For gas stoves, ensure gas grates and burners are kept clean and free of debris to allow for consistent gas flow and proper ignition. Familiarize yourself with your stove’s operational manual to understand any specific maintenance requirements.
